Block Wall Replacement in Fairfield County, CT
Block wall replacement services involve removing and reconstructing existing masonry walls that have become damaged, deteriorated, or no longer serve their intended purpose. These projects often include replacing retaining walls, garden boundaries, or security barriers, ensuring the new structures are durable and visually appealing. Property owners typically seek this service when their current walls show signs of significant cracking, bowing, or structural failure, or when aesthetic improvements are desired to enhance curb appeal.
Before requesting block wall replacement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the removal process, materials used, and the expected lifespan of the new wall. It’s also important to consider factors such as permits, design options, and how the replacement will integrate with existing landscaping or property features. Clear communication about these elements can help ensure the project meets both functional needs and aesthetic preferences.

Block Wall Replacement Questions
What are common reasons to replace a block wall? Block walls may need replacement due to cracking, bowing, or deterioration from weather exposure over time.
How can I tell if my block wall needs replacement? Signs include visible cracks, leaning, or crumbling mortar, indicating structural issues that may require replacement.
What types of projects typically involve block wall replacement? Projects often include rebuilding retaining walls, garden boundaries, or support structures that have become unstable or damaged.
What should property owners consider before replacing a block wall? It's important to assess the wall's condition, determine the desired appearance, and plan for proper drainage and reinforcement needs.
